RULE §114.656Eligible Grant Amounts

(a) The eligible grant amount for each heavy-duty on-road vehicle being replaced is up to 80%, as determined by the executive director, of the total cost for replacement.

(b) The eligible grant amount for each light-duty on-road vehicle being replaced is up to 80%, as determined by the executive director, of the total cost for replacement.

(c) The executive director may establish more specific standards for determining grant amounts within the maximum percentage of total costs established under this section consistent with the priorities for project selection, including consideration of the federal emission standards for different model years of heavy-duty engines and light-duty vehicles, decisions on pollutants of concern, and other factors that will help implement the project priorities.

(d) To be eligible for replacement, vehicles and engines imported into the United States from another country must have met all applicable emissions certification requirements for importation.


Source Note: The provisions of this §114.656 adopted to be effective March 18, 2010, 35 TexReg 2195; amended to be effective May 1, 2014, 39 TexReg 3435
